Paper Summary:

The paper assesses the organizational change at the 1800ASKGARY company, a unique business model that links 3 stakeholders: accident victims in need of medical and legal services, physicians and attorneys.

From the Paper:

"ASKGARY is a unique business model that links three stakeholders; accident victims in need of medical and legal services, physicians and attorneys. Currently, the company is expanding dramatically from its origins in Florida where the founder, Dr Gary, recognized a need for such a service and entered the market as a first mover. The changes taking place in this company are both broad and deep. From a small mom and pop operation located in Florida, the organization has expanded throughout the entire state and..."
